“…aceticum was the first acetogen to be isolated, from a soil sample in 1936 [134,135], although the strain was subsequently lost [136]. In 1980, spores of the original strain were serendipitously found and reactivated [136], while at the same time it was separately re-isolated [137].…”

“…Subsequently, Klass Wieringa [21] isolated Clostridium aceticum, demonstrating synthesis of acetic acid from H 2 /CO 2 by this pure culture. The type culture for acetogenesis, Clostridium thermoaceticum, reclassified as Moorella thermoacetica [22], was isolated by Francis Fontaine [23].…”
